Subtract 50/7 from 42/14
1st number: 3 0/14, 2nd number: 7 1/7
42/14 - 50/7 is -29/7.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 14 and 7 is 14
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 14 - For the 1st fraction, since 14 × 1 = 14,
42/14 = 42 × 1/14 × 1 = 42/14 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 7 × 2 = 14,
50/7 = 50 × 2/7 × 2 = 100/14 - Subtract the two like fractions:
42/14 - 100/14 = 42 - 100/14 = -58/14 - After reducing the fraction, the answer is -29/7
